Discover LudwigThe phrase "aggregated wealth"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to refer to the total wealth accumulated by a group or entity, often in discussions about economics or finance.
Example: "The study revealed that the aggregated wealth of the top 1% has increased significantly over the past decade."
Alternatives: "total wealth" or "cumulative wealth".
